Complete Tax Breakdown

Detailed line-by-line tax calculation for a First-Line Supervisors of Entertainment and Recreation Workers, Except Gambling Services earning $41,350 in Louisiana (single filer, standard deduction).

Tax Component Annual Amount Effective Rate
Gross Salary (Median) $41,350
Federal Income Tax -$2,978 7.2%
Louisiana State Income Tax -$1,241 3.0%
Social Security (OASDI) -$2,563 6.2%
Medicare -$599 1.5%
Total Taxes -$7,382 17.9%
Take-Home Pay $33,967 82.1%

After-Tax Pay by Experience Level

Take-home pay varies significantly across experience levels. Here is the after-tax breakdown for each salary percentile of First-Line Supervisors of Entertainment and Recreation Workers, Except Gambling Services in Louisiana.

Percentile Gross Salary Total Taxes Take-Home Pay Tax Rate
10th Percentile (P10) $28,950 -$4,511 $24,438 15.6%
25th Percentile (P25) $31,330 -$5,062 $26,267 16.2%
Median (P50) $41,350 -$7,382 $33,967 17.9%
75th Percentile (P75) $52,000 -$9,862 $42,137 19.0%
90th Percentile (P90) $73,750 -$16,261 $57,488 22.0%

How is First-Line Supervisors of Entertainment and Recreation Workers, Except Gambling Services take-home pay in Louisiana calculated?

We start with the 2025 BLS median salary of $41,350 for First-Line Supervisors of Entertainment and Recreation Workers, Except Gambling Services in Louisiana, then subtract: federal income tax using 2024 IRS brackets ($14,600 standard deduction), Louisiana state income tax (progressive (up to 4.2%)), Social Security (6.2% up to $168,600), and Medicare (1.45%). The result — $33,967/yr — does not include local taxes, pre-tax deductions (401k, HSA), or tax credits.

Tax Calculation Assumptions

This estimate assumes a single filer using the 2024 standard deduction ($14,600), with W-2 employment income only. It does not account for: itemized deductions, tax credits (e.g. earned income credit, child tax credit), local/city taxes, pre-tax contributions (401k, HSA, FSA), self-employment tax, or additional income sources. Actual take-home pay may differ. Consult a tax professional for personalized advice.
